We worked on the touch controls extensively to give complete 360 batting shot control. So the player can decide which direction he needs to slide his finger on the screen and the ball follows exactly on that line. In the gameplay video a green line appears on the bottom right part of the screen indicating the action realtime direction of the ball. The same display also shows fielders and the ball movement update on that display.
